Abstract

We present ARIES a multi-agent single and multi-Unmanned Aerial Vehicles (UAV) approach for full building inspection following disasters in search and rescue operations (SAR). Our system addresses compute challenges and time constraints of autonomous inspections. ARIES employs a two-pronged strategy. We deploy a robust single UAV for exterior inspection, identifying potential failure points from structural damage (cracks and spalls). Identified points are priority areas for intelligent interior swarm exploration. These interior UAVs use thermal imaging to identify people in low-light. ARIES combines deep neural networks for vision tasks and heuristic algorithms for path planning tasks. It leverages You Only Look Once model (YOLO) variants YOLOv8-nano and YOLO12-nano for inference on edge devices and efficient lightweight path planning using Travelling Salesman Problem, Rapidly-Exploring Random Tree∗, A∗, and D∗ Lite. This work compares trade-offs for efficient computational offloading in a real-world application. We show that onboard computation on a Raspberry Pi can detect exterior structural damage in ∼2s at 0.64 and 0.67 recall for cracks and spalls respectively. Additionally, at Ground Control Station, we achieve 0.85 recall for human detection during interior inspection.
